Chris, I think it's MythTV related. When watching Live-TV, I sometimes get a pauze after a couple of seconds; after that Live-TV continues without problems. The pauze seems to procude these errors (I never noticed them before with 0.3.6o). I read others on the MythTV-alias describing this problem (the pauze) but it doesn't bother me that much so I never really looked into it.
